US inflicted severe blows on global economy: Venezuela's Maduro

The Venezuelan leader condemns US global conduct and praises rising Venezuela-China ties, citing economic growth, diversification, and a break from IMF institutions.

The United States is attempting to impose conditions on countries to drag them into hostility with China, indicated Venezuelan President Nicolas Maduro, adding that "Washington acted poorly when it attacked the world."

Speaking during his weekly program, Maduro emphasized that the US has inflicted severe blows on global supply and logistics chains, impacting its own domestic economy. He warned that further side effects may emerge in the future.

Earlier this month, Washington imposed a 25% tariff on imports of Venezuelan oil and gas—a move analysts say could most severely affect China, Venezuela’s largest oil buyer.

The Venezuelan leader underscored that Washington must correct its course and abandon attempts to dominate and colonize the world, asserting that the 21st century has no place for imperialism or threats against nations.

He also praised the American people’s awareness, saying they understand the importance of building positive relations with China and the world and are demanding an end to hegemonic policies, as well as rejecting the stigmatization and discrimination of migrants.

US President Donald Trump has imposed 10% tariffs on most US trading partners and a separate 145% levy on many products from China. Beijing has responded with 125% tariffs of its own on US goods.

Strengthening partnership with China National Petroleum Corporation

Separately, Maduro announced the strengthening of the strategic partnership between Venezuela and the China National Petroleum Corporation (CNPC), highlighting that bilateral ties have reached the highest levels of trust and mutual reliance.

He noted that Executive Vice President Delcy Rodriguez made a successful working visit to China to focus on the details of economic coordination between the two countries.

Maduro also confirmed that Venezuela has recorded 16 consecutive quarters of economic growth, highlighting a notable surge in commercial activity and harmonized growth across all economic drivers, with oil no longer being the sole engine of expansion.

The Venezuelan president added that entrepreneurship grew by 59% in 2024 and affirmed that his country has severed all ties with the International Monetary Fund and its affiliated institutions.
